According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 107 reports of Respiratory disorder have been filed in association with CAFFEINE (Caffeine Citrate). This represents 3.4% of all adverse event reports for CAFFEINE.

How Dangerous Is Respiratory disorder From CAFFEINE?
Of the 107 reports, 84 (78.5%) resulted in death, 85 (79.4%) required hospitalization, and 83 (77.6%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Respiratory disorder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for CAFFEINE. However, 107 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
